- Read lessPG:- Students whose submitted an official baccalaureate degree conferred transcript shows a cumulative GPA of at least a 2.0 but below 2.5 will be admitted under a "conditional basis" category. These students will be limited to one course per term prior to advancement to candidacy. UG:- The University may choose to admit a student whose academic credentials fall below stated requirements on a conditional basis. Students who are accepted on a conditional basis may be required to take specific courses during their first semester at the University and consult with representatives of the University's Academic Resource Center.

MA in Migration, Climate Change and the Environment at Webster University Highlights
- The master of arts in migration, climate change and the environment (MAMCE) focuses on the migration, environmental degradation and climate change nexus
- The MAMCE provides students with an up-to-date and in-depth understanding of modern migration dynamics and policy developments and with an original lens of how migration policy connects to other policy areas.
- Students will gain specialized expertise in research methodologies, gathering and analyzing data and evidence on migration and environment, and will acquire the skills required to analyze the role of migration in international environmental law, especially climate change law
- This program is offered by the College of Humanities and Social Sciences and is only available at the Geneva campus in partnership with the UN Migration Agency (International Organization for Migration or IOM)
